The Ministry of Trade and Services today stated that the 4th session of the joint expert working group for commercial and economic cooperation between the Serbian government and the City of Moscow will begin on December 8.
Working group co-presidents Minister of Trade and Services Slobodan Milosavljevic and Minister of the Moscow City Government Mikhail Mikhailovich Vyshegorodtsev will open the plenary meeting, after which the possibilities for improving economic cooperation will be discussed.
The Moscow City delegation comprises representatives of the City Government, the Moscow Chamber of Industry and Commerce, the Moscow Centre for Developing Entrepreneurship and businessmen from this city.
Minister Vyshegorodtsev will also meet with Serbian Minister of Infrastructure Milutin Mrkonjic and Belgrade mayor Dragan Djilas.
On the second day of the visit the Moscow delegation will visit Jagodina and meet with Jagodina mayor Dragan Markovic. Ministers Milosavljevic and Vyshegorodtsev will also sign the protocol of the working group’s meeting.
